1. Overview
1.1. ProductDescription
R27A
AkuvoxR27AisaSIP‐compliant,hands‐freeandvideooutdoorphone.Itcanbe
connectedwithyourAkuvoxIPPhoneforremoteunlockcontrolandmonitor.You
canoperatetheindoorhandsettocommunicatewithvisitorsviavoiceandvideo,
andunlockthedoorifyouwish.UserscanalsouseRFcardtounlockthe
door(R27AConly).It’sapplicableinvillas,officeandsoon.

2. Configuration
2.1. Administratorinterface
Press*2396#toenteradministratorinterface.Administratorinterfaceprovidessome
advancedpermissionstoadministrators,includingSystemInformation,Admin
SettingsandSystemSettings.
2.1.1SystemInformation
Press1toenterSystemInformationtocheckIPaddress,MacaddressandFirmware
versionofthedoorphone.
2.1.2AdminSettings
2.1.2.1Admincardsetting
Addadmincard
EnterAdminCardSettinginterface,andpress1toquickaddadmincard.Whenyou
see“PleaseSwipeAdminCard...”,pleaseplaceadmincardintheRFcardreaderarea.
Afterthescreenshows“Anadmincardisadded+1”,itmeansaddingsuccessfully.
Cleanadmincarddata
EnterAdminCardSettinginterface,press2todeletethecurrentadmincard.When
yousee“PleaseSwipeAdminCard....”,andplacetheaddedadmincardyouwantto
deleteintheRFcardarea.Afterthescreenshows“Anadmincardisdeleted”,it
meansdeletingsuccessfully.

6
2.1.2.2AdminCodeSetting
Admincodeisusedtoenteradministratorinterface.Thedefaultcodeis2396.Enter
AdminCodeSettingtoinput4digitnewadmincodes,clickDialkey tosave.
2.1.2.3ServiceCodeSetting
ServiceCodeSettingisusedtoenteruserinterface.Thedefaultcodeis3888.Enter
servicecodesettingtoinput4digitnewusercodes,andclickDialkey tosave.

3. BasicUsing
3.1. Makeacall
Intheidleinterface,presstheaccountorIPaddress+Dialkey tomakeacall.
3.2. Receiveacall
R27Xwillautoanswertheincomingcallbydefault.Ifusersdisableautoanswer
function,theycanpressdialkeytoanswertheincomingcall.
3.3. Unlock
UnlockbyPincode:UserscanunlockthedoorbyusingpredefinedPublicPinor
PrivatePin.Press#+8digitPinCode+#tounlock,thenyouwillhear“Thedooris
nowopened”.IfusersinputthewrongPincode,thescreenwillshow“Incorrect
Code”.
UnlockbyRFCard(OnlyR27A):PlacethepredefinedusercardinRFcardreaderto
unlock.Undernormalconditions,thephonewillannounce“Thedoorisnow
opened”.Ifthecardhasnotbeenregistered,thephonewillshow“Unauthorized”.
UnlockbyDTMFCode:Duringthetalking,thepresidentcanpressthepredefined
DTMFcodetoremoteunlockthedoor.(Pleaserefertochapter4.4.4aboutDTMF
codesetting).Thenyouwillalsohear“Thedoorisnowopened”.

9
4. Web
4.1. ObtainIPaddress
TheAkuvoxR27AuseDHCPIPbydefault.Press*2396#toenterAdministrator
interface.EnterSystemInformationtocheckthephoneIPaddress.
4.2. Logintheweb
OpenaWebBrowser,andenterthecorrespondingIPaddress.Then,typethedefault
usernameandpasswordasbelowtologin:
Username:admin
Password:admin

4.4.3Relay
SectionsDescription
PrivateKey ImportorExportthePrivateKeytemplate.
RelayToconfiguresomesettingsaboutunlock
RelaySelect:R27Asupport3relays
RelayType:Differentlocksusedifferentrelaytypes,default
stateorinvertstate.IfyouconnecttheLockinNO
connector,selectdefaultstate.Otherwiseusinginvert

14
state.
RelayDelay(sec):Allowsdoorremain“open”forcertain
periodTherangeisfrom1to10seconds
DTMFOption:R27Asupport1、2、3、4digitsDTMFunlock
code.Pleaseselectonetypeandenterthecorresponding
code.
DTMF:Setup1digitDTMFcodeforremoteunlock
MultipleDTMF:SetupmultipledigitsDTMFcodefor
remoteunlock.
Status:thestatuswillbechangedbytherelaystate.
OpenRelayviaHTTPUserscanuseaURLtoremoteunlockthedoor.
Switch:Enablethisfunction.Disablebydefault.
Username&password:Userscansetuptheusernameand
passwordforHTTPunlock.Nullbydefault
URLformat:http://192.168.1.102/fcgi/do?action=OpenDoor&
UserName=&Password=&DoorNum=1
